Output 61e41546074e104f175c16c58e93ec38790f477e57b12200cd9bd80ed6ba5981:0

value
70590000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3af6a97a64b80d7ef4de46d43ca55bd99deb9715 OP_EQUALVERIFY OP_CHECKSIG
address
16NmgWEaQqeVdHu176afa7dwgZ8KNxZXqN
transaction
61e41546074e104f175c16c58e93ec38790f477e57b12200cd9bd80ed6ba5981
spent
true